News summary

The NBA unveiled alternate court designs by artist Victor Solomon for all 30 teams for the 2025 Emirates NBA Cup, featuring team-specific gradients, Cup-trophy artwork and prior champions' winning years displayed at center. The Cup begins Oct. 31 with Prime Video doubleheaders and themed "Cup Nights," and group play runs through late November with teams placed into five-team pods that play each opponent once. Group winners and conference wild cards advance to a single-elimination knockout stage, with ties broken by head-to-head results and point differential. Quarterfinals will be held in early December hosted by higher seeds, semifinals are scheduled for Dec. 13 and the Finals for Dec. 16 in Las Vegas. Games count toward the regular-season standings (teams will play 82 or 83 games depending on advancement), and Emirates' sponsorship brings reported prize money for the champion while Prime Video holds exclusive rights to knockout-round coverage.
